Detailed experience with my Labrador
I purchased a Labrador Retriever from PuppySpot a few months ago and wanted to share my experience. The ordering process was straightforward online. I filled out some details about what I was looking for, and they showed me available puppies. Once I selected my pup, the payment process was smooth. Delivery took 8 days to reach me in California, which was within the timeframe they gave me. The puppy arrived with all its health records and a starter kit, which was a nice touch. I had a couple of questions about the health guarantee after he arrived, and customer support was responsive when I called them; they explained everything clearly. My Labrador is now settled in, very playful, and has had no health issues. The breeder screening seemed to pay off. Overall, it was a positive experience.
